| Title |
Pituitary apoplexy presenting with light-near dissociation of the pupils. |

| Abstract |
We describe a patient with pituitary apoplexy causing sudden visual loss and light-near dissociation of the pupils but minimal ophthalmoplegia. Good visual recovery occurred despite an 8-day delay in neurosurgical treatment. |
